I just got a set of Black East Indies Eggs this weekend. They came shipped from Chicago to New York. I let them sit in the carton 24 hours, fat end up. I put them in the bator last night.

I checked them all and they seem to have very stable air cells. No wiggle, a few with a slightly odd shape but no movement when gently rolled.

My question is how long should I let them set in my bator not being turned before I set them in my turner.
 
I Usually Start Turning The Next Day.(24 Hours After I Put Them In The Incubator.)
